092809goodquest1.jpgQ: We are working on a kitchen re-model and I love the kitchen in this photo and would like the AT-ers help with a question about where to find the bar stools in this photo. I love love love them and would like to find out where they came from and/or who the designer is. I assume they are custom covered in that fabric, but if anyone could tell me where the original white bar stools came from it would be much appreciated!

They look like Cherner chairs.

Looks like the white Cherner barstool with custom upholstery:

They're Cherner Barstools that have been customized with owners fabric www.chernerchair.com
